This white net curtain has been made using an ancient Korean technique, Pojagi or Bojagi, part of the traditional art of patchwork. The different linen voile parts have been delicately sewn together. In addition to the making of the composition, the textile was naturally hand dyed with walnut stain. Placed on a window to play with the light, the piece takes on the appearance of a 'textile stained glass window'.
